Analyzing Recent Performances
The New York Rangers have shown remarkable resilience and skill in their recent games. Their victory over the Nashville Predators with a commanding 4-0 scoreline showcased their defensive prowess and offensive firepower. The team's goaltender played a pivotal role, saving all shots faced, leading to a shutout victory. This performance was complemented by an efficient power play and strong even-strength play.
However, in their subsequent game against the Toronto Maple Leafs, the Rangers experienced a slight hiccup, falling 2-3 in a closely contested match. Despite outshooting their opponents and dominating faceoffs, they were unable to capitalize on power play opportunities which could have turned the game in their favor.
Their resilience was once again on display when they faced off against the New York Islanders. Dominating with a 5-1 victory, they exhibited an exceptional shooting percentage and balanced strength across all facets of play—powerplay, shorthanded situations, and even strength—highlighting their ability to adapt and overcome challenges.
